André Villas-Boas makes history at FC Porto: the revolution that led the club to its 31st national title
FC Porto marks a historic moment: winning its 31st national championship, achieved in emphatic fashion under the leadership of André Villas-Boas. At 48, Villas-Boas adds an unprecedented achievement to his career, becoming national champion for the first time as club president, in his second season at the helm. After a debut campaign marked by setbacks and difficulties, the former coach shaped FC Porto into a strong and virtually unbeatable team, combining strategy, financial discipline, and team spirit.
The secret to success lay in the right choice of Francesco Farioli to lead the coaching staff. Villas-Boas found in the Italian the ideal name, someone capable of understanding not only the tactical dimension, but also the identity and soul of the club. The “Porto family,” despite an irreparable loss, managed to close ranks around a common goal, shaping a team that never left any doubt about its superiority.
This title means far more than a simple sporting victory: it symbolizes a profound transformation at FC Porto, the result of exemplary management covering every area, from the transfer market to institutional communication, without forgetting financial stabilization. The club’s recovery was complete and unexpected, a true change of cycle that promises to bring even more joy to Porto supporters.
André Villas-Boas is not just a figure associated with success on the pitch; as president, he also proves he knows how to build a solid project, grounded in values, competence, and a clearly defined strategic vision. FC Porto’s future is secure, and this season will forever remain in the memory of the fans as the period in which the blue-and-white revolution was definitively consolidated.
